返回列表 發帖
本帖最後由 潘憶承 於 2019-8-7 13:31 編輯
  1. import java.util.Scanner;

  2. public class Ch01{        
  3.         static int fai(int n)
  4.         {
  5.                 if(n<2)   
  6.                         return n;
  7.                 else
  8.                         return fai(n-2)+fai(n-1);
  9.         }

  10.         public static void main(String[] args)
  11.         {
  12.                 int n;
  13.                 Scanner s=new Scanner(System.in);
  14.                 System.out.println("請問要推算費氏數列到第幾項次?");
  15.                 n=s.nextInt();
  16.                 for(int i=0;i<=n;i++)
  17.                 {
  18.                         System.out.println(fai(i)+" ");
  19.                 }   
  20.         }
  21. }
複製代碼

TOP

返回列表